Machine Learning Engineering Salaries in San Francisco
Explore Machine Learning Engineering salaries across 36 jobs in San Francisco
Average salary range
$232.9k – $345.0k
Based on 36 jobs · 9% more than the average Machine Learning Engineering salary on Inference Jobs
25th percentile
$178.8k
Average
$288.9k
75th percentile
$390k
Machine Learning Engineering salary by seniority
| Seniority | Avg. salary | Jobs |
|---|---|---|
| Mid Level | $219.2k – $315.7k | 8 |
| Senior | $245.7k – $367.4k | 24 |
Machine Learning Engineering salaries in other locations
Santa Clara
Avg. $179.5k – $326.6k · 15 jobs
Sunnyvale
Avg. $182.2k – $277.3k · 6 jobs
Palo Alto
Avg. $180k – $440k · 3 jobs
Top paying titles in San Francisco
Software Engineering
Avg. $227.4k – $329.8k · 212 jobs
Machine Learning Engineer
Avg. $244.7k – $355.8k · 82 jobs
DevOps
Avg. $219.5k – $312.4k · 74 jobs
Software Engineer
Avg. $236.1k – $341.8k · 73 jobs
Infrastructure Engineering
Avg. $243.3k – $356.5k · 67 jobs
Platform Engineering
Avg. $231.7k – $325.8k · 66 jobs
Top paying skills in San Francisco
Python
Avg. $225.2k – $314.6k · 346 jobs
Machine Learning
Avg. $237.8k – $338.2k · 180 jobs
Data Analysis
Avg. $213.3k – $278.0k · 144 jobs
Kubernetes
Avg. $213.9k – $293.8k · 133 jobs
Distributed Systems
Avg. $239.1k – $345.0k · 130 jobs
AWS
Avg. $216.9k – $300.9k · 103 jobs
Machine Learning Engineering salary FAQs for San Francisco
All salary figures are normalized to USD annual equivalents. Averages are based on published jobs with salary data and filtered for statistical outliers.